Offering Physical & Online Classes—Choose the Learning Style that Suits You Best!
— Learn

WordPress for Beginners

This all-inclusive course takes you from WordPress basics to advanced development. Whether you’re new to WordPress or looking to expand your skills, this course will cover everything you need to know to build and customize professional websites. By the end, you’ll be able to create fully functional, secure, and optimized WordPress sites from scratch.

Additionally

you’ll gain an understanding of major freelancing platforms like Fiverr and Upwork. Learn how to create a profile, showcase your new WordPress skills, and start earning by building websites for clients worldwide.

What You’ll Learn

Learn the basics of the WordPress platform and how to navigate it.
Set up WordPress, navigate the dashboard, and customize themes without code.
Build stunning layouts with Elementor and WPBakery.
Enhance your site’s functionality with popular plugins.
Build professional websites using ready-made themes and customization options.
Understand branding and how to choose a design that aligns with your business.
Design your website based on your business’s branding and goals.
Optimize your WordPress site for speed and smooth user experience.
Integrate these technologies into your WordPress development workflow.

Advanced Learning

  • Overview of WordPress architecture, file structure, and theme/plugin hierarchy.
  • Understanding WordPress actions, filters, and hooks.
  • The WordPress loop: how it works and how to modify it.
  • Conditional tags and their importance in theme development.
  • Understand the difference between actions and filters in WordPress.
  • Learn how to add custom functionality using Hooks.
  • Modify WordPress default behavior with hooks and apply it to real-world examples.
  • Learn the structure of WordPress themes.
  • Building a fully custom theme from the ground up.
  • Integrating theme settings and customizing the appearance.
  • Introduction to custom post types.
  • Creating and registering custom post types.
  • Overview of necessary archive and single post pages.
  • Adding custom meta fields.
  • Storing additional data within posts.
  • Displaying custom fields on the front-end.
  • Introduction to custom taxonomies.
  • Associating taxonomies with custom post types.
  • Displaying and managing taxonomies on your site.
  • Querying custom post types.
  • Using WordPress loops to display posts.
  • Customizing the display of post listings.
  • Creating templates for single post detail views.
  • Displaying dynamic content using custom fields.
  • Adding related posts and taxonomy terms.
  • Creating dynamic menus.
  • Registering and adding menus to theme templates.
  • Managing and displaying multiple menus.
  • Creating dynamic header and footer sections.
  • Customizing for different templates and pages.
  • Managing header and footer content dynamically.
  • Creating and registering custom widget areas.
  • Adding dynamic sidebars to themes.
  • Managing widgets within WordPress admin.
  • Building a custom error page.
  • Displaying useful information on the 404 page.
  • Customizing the design to fit your theme.
  • Customizing WooCommerce shop and product pages.
  • Overriding WooCommerce templates.
  • Advanced customization of the checkout and cart pages.
  • Customize WooCommerce Email templates
  • Adding third-party payment gateways.
  • Integrating custom payment APIs with WooCommerce.
  • Testing and managing payment functionality.
  • Introduction to WordPress plugins.
  • Creating a simple plugin from start to finish.
  • Understanding the plugin directory structure.
  • Building a custom “Request a Quote” plugin.
  • Managing form submissions and quote requests.
  • Displaying quote functionality on the front-end.
  • Display User queries in admin dashboard.
  • Convert query to WooCommerce order.
  • Overview of REST API in WordPress.
  • Using REST API to interact with WordPress data.
  • Create Your Own API’s in WordPress
  • Extending and customizing API responses.
  • Understanding WordPress database architecture.
  • Exploring and managing database tables.
  • Optimizing database queries and performance.
  • Creating custom tables in the WordPress database.
  • Storing and retrieving data from custom tables.
  • Displaying custom table data on the front-end using custom code and elementor as well.
Learn advanced techniques to speed up your WordPress sites.
Implement advanced security measures to protect your WordPress installations.
Support groups for students to ask questions and get help from instructors and peers.

Elementor Related Points

Learn to create dynamic page templates using the Elementor page builder, allowing for easy reuse and customization of layouts.
Create custom queries in Elementor to display specific loop items dynamically on pages or posts.
Develop custom widgets for Elementor to extend its functionality and tailor it to your project’s needs.

Who Should Enroll

Enroll Now to become a complete WordPress expert and successful freelancer!